Ireland will face Afghanistan in the opening ODI of the Afghanistan tour of Ireland 2026 on 5th August at the Bready Cricket Club, Northern Ireland. After Hashmatullah Shahidi stepped down from the captaincy, Rahmat Shah led the Afghan team. Their recent form has been poor, having lost the previous ODI series 0-3 against India, and they will be eager to make a strong comeback in this series.

Meanwhile, Ireland skipper Paul Stirling joins the team after recovering from a calf muscle injury. They entered this series with high confidence after defeating the Indian team in the recent T20I series and also drawing the ODI series against West Indies.

IRE vs AFG Pitch Report - Bready Cricket Club, Northern Ireland 

The wicket prepared at Bready Cricket Club will provide something for the quick bowlers with the new ball. The batsmen will need to see off the new-ball to score big runs on this surface.

  • Win Batting First: 40%

  • Win Bowling First: 60%
